The Rise of the Roblox Economy
Behind career Roblox is a robust virtual economy. Players purchase Robux, Roblox's in-game currency, to buy items, avatar accessories, and access premium features. Creators earn Robux through game passes, advertisements, and virtual item sales, which can be converted into real-world currency through the Developer Exchange program (DevEx).
This economic framework has encouraged many users to think beyond playing and into crafting experiences and products that attract audiences and generate income. The potential for earning has made Roblox not just a gaming platform but a legitimate avenue for career growth.
Popular Career Paths Within Roblox
Exploring career Roblox means understanding the diversity of roles that exist within this ecosystem. Here are some of the most common and promising career paths:
1. Roblox Game Developer
Developers are the backbone of Roblox. They create games using Roblox Studio, designing everything from simple obstacle courses to complex simulations. Successful developers often possess skills in scripting (Lua), 3D modeling, game design, and user experience.
Tips for aspiring developers:
- Start with small projects to build your skills.
- Join Roblox developer communities to learn and collaborate.
- Stay updated with Roblox’s platform updates and new features.
- Focus on creating engaging gameplay that keeps players coming back.
2. 3D Modeler and Designer
Visual appeal matters a lot in Roblox games. 3D modelers create characters, environments, and assets that make games immersive and visually attractive. Knowledge of software like Blender, alongside Roblox Studio, can set you apart.
Designers can also create avatar accessories and clothing items, which can be sold in the Roblox catalog, opening up another revenue stream.
3. Content Creator and Influencer
Many Roblox players have built careers as content creators on platforms like YouTube and Twitch. By streaming gameplay, offering tutorials, or showcasing new games and items, they attract large audiences and monetize through ads, sponsorships, and donations.
Content creators often collaborate with developers to promote games, making this a symbiotic relationship within the Roblox community.
4. Community Manager and Moderator
With millions of active users, maintaining a healthy and safe community is vital. Community managers and moderators help enforce rules, engage with players, and manage feedback. These roles are crucial for large development teams or Roblox groups.
5. Virtual Entrepreneur
Some users take advantage of Roblox’s marketplace to create and sell virtual goods, such as clothing, accessories, or game passes. Successful entrepreneurs analyze trends and player preferences to design products that sell well, combining creativity with business savvy.

Roblox Developer Economy: A New Frontier
Central to the concept of career Roblox is the thriving developer economy. Roblox developers create immersive environments and interactive experiences that attract millions of players. Through the Developer Exchange Program (DevEx), creators can convert their in-game currency (Robux) into real-world income, incentivizing high-quality content production.
Key statistics highlight the platform’s economic potential:
- Over 9 million active developers creating content monthly.
- Developer payouts exceeding $500 million annually as of recent reports.
- Top developers earning millions of dollars by creating popular games and virtual items.
These figures underscore the viability of career Roblox as a sustainable income source, especially for younger demographics seeking alternative career paths outside traditional employment models.

Challenges and Considerations in Pursuing a Career Roblox
While the prospects are promising, career Roblox is not without challenges. The platform’s competitive nature requires consistent innovation and quality to maintain player interest. Developers must navigate intellectual property concerns, platform policies, and evolving player expectations.
Furthermore, income variability can be significant, with many creators earning modest sums while a few achieve substantial success. This disparity necessitates a strategic approach to game development and monetization.
Parental guidance and awareness are also critical, especially given Roblox’s popularity among younger users. Ensuring safe and positive experiences while encouraging skill development is essential for nurturing future career professionals within the platform.
